This page documents how Hushline release artifacts are traced from source to deployment. Each deduplicator build is produced on an isolated runner, with dependencies pinned by lockfile hash and no network access during compilation. The signing step records the commit, runner image digest, and pipeline run in an attestation stored alongside the artifact. Reviewers should confirm that the attestation chain is unbroken before approving promotion. The artifact currently under review is identified by the token below.

trace token, kajef-bahip: htk14_d9270d12f0002c

Priority: High. The Duskmill read-replica lag alarm fires correctly, but downstream consumers reject the alert payload with a signature mismatch. Root cause: the alerting sidecar was redeployed last Thursday with a stale verification bundle, so every lag notification since then has been dropped, not delivered. Support should tell affected customers that lag monitoring itself was unaffected — only notifications failed. Fix is rolling out now; consumers must update their verification config to the new key below.

deploy key for kahof-tadup: bky4_rRMZ

## Tuning

The Mosswick controller corrects slow sensor drift with an exponential baseline per probe. Reviewer notes: the smoothing window must stay longer than the irrigation cycle or corrections chase watering events; the clamp exists so a failing probe can't drag the baseline. Changing any of these requires re-running the drift replay suite against the Ashgrove fixture set. Current values are below.

tuning constants:
QUOTAS = {
    "druwyn": 5,
    "holix": 5,
    "zorath": 5,
    "holwyn": 10,
}

Ticket: Extract user module from the Pellwood monolith. Scope for this sprint is carving the user-profile and session code into the new Fenrow service without changing public API paths. Do not touch billing hooks yet. Acceptance: contract tests green on both sides. The extraction branch builds under the token shown below.

session token of kafof-kafop = htk31_c3becf8b8eac3ed970037fba36e258e